Description & Requirements

We are seeking a Business Systems Analyst to join our Group IT team at our Head Offices in Victoria Park. You'll report to the Business Systems Lead and will be responsible for supporting and enhancing core business platforms to improve operational efficiency. This role involves working closely with stakeholders to analyse business needs, optimise workflows, and deliver system enhancements and integrations.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Administer & Optimise the Recruitment Platform: Manage platform configuration, workflows, automation, and performance to ensure reliable, scalable and positive business outcomes
  • Implement Best Practices: Work within an ITIL framework to manage IT changes, safeguarding business operations from disruptions and maintaining a high level of service delivery.
  • Engage with Stakeholders: Build strong working relationships with business users to understand requirements and translate them into practical business outcomes.
  • Support a Diverse User Base: Provide high quality support to a wide range of customers, both in our office and at various site locations, adapting to different needs and environments.
  • Collaborate for Success: Work closely with other teams to integrate and optimise our systems, driving innovation and ensuring seamless service across the organisation.
What you’ll bring:
  • Hands on experience administering and developing within an enterprise talent platform (experience with Avature highly regarded).
  • Practical experience using Python and relational databases (e.g. MySQL) to build automation, workflows, and data-driven solutions.
  • Experience working with web technologies such as JavaScript, HTML, and CSS to configure and enhance user interfaces.
  • Strong communication skills and a service-focused, detail-oriented approach.
  • A strong willingness to learn new systems, adapt to evolving technologies and processes, and continuously enhance systems capability and personal technical skills.

About us
Monadelphous is an ASX-200 company providing multidisciplinary construction, maintenance and industrial services to many of the largest companies in the resources, energy and infrastructure sectors. Established in 1972, we’ve been working in Australia and around the world for more than 50 years.
